How to Configure Branch-Specific Appearance in Koha Theme Builder™

Guide to configuring global theme settings and branch-specific overrides in Koha Theme Builder™ while maintaining system-wide consistency.

This guide shows you how to use global theme settings and branch-specific overrides safely in Theme Builder.

What this element controls

Which visual settings remain global and which can vary by branch.

Where patrons see it

Across OPAC screens when branch context is active.

Why this matters

Branch flexibility is useful, but uncontrolled differences can confuse patrons and weaken brand consistency.

Before you start

  • Define non-negotiable global brand rules
  • Identify branch-specific needs (hours, announcements, spotlight content)
  • Confirm branch-level edit permissions

Step-by-step

  1. Open Theme Builder.
  2. Set global baseline family, preset, and branding.
  3. Enable branch override scope (if available in your environment).
  4. Apply minimal branch-specific overrides first.
  5. Preview branch A and branch B side by side.
  6. Verify navigation and account consistency.
  7. Save draft, review with branch owners.
  8. Publish in controlled phases.

For multi-branch libraries Launch with one global baseline and only essential branch overrides. Expand gradually after consistency checks.

Common mistakes

  • Allowing branch overrides for core brand tokens too early
  • Applying many branch differences before baseline QA
  • Forgetting to test search and account pages per branch

Next Steps

More in Koha System

Was this article helpful?

Thanks for your feedback!